> In April, chat app Discord announced it is testing face scans in the UK and Australia. Regulators in Germany have been pursuing age checks—going as far as to fine individuals posting on X (then Twitter) in 2023—for years. Last week, Pornhub returned to France—it pulled services relating to the country’s age checking at the start of June—after a court ruling limited the law. And by July this year, porn sites and social media platforms operating in the UK are required to introduce “robust” age checks. Pornhub owner Aylo announced on Thursday that it would adopt "government approved age assurance methods” to comply with the law.
